Hotels in Italy
7556

Hotels 4 stars near Ottaviano - San Pietro - Musei Vaticani Station, Roma

AS Vaticano Apartment
AS Vaticano Apartment Map AS Vaticano Apartment
Via tolemaide, 28, 00072 Roma
AS Vaticano Apartment offers accommodations in Rome, 1.7 miles from Piazza Navona and 1.9 miles from Piazza del Popolo. The property is close to several well-known attractions, a 12-minute walk from The Vatican, 0.8 miles from St. Peter's Basilica, and 1.1 miles from Castel Sant'Angelo. Free Wifi is...
9.2 Exceptional
Relais della Torre
Relais della Torre Map Relais della Torre
Piazza dell'unità 9, 00184 Roma
Just a 9-minute walk from Vatican Museums and half a mile from Lepanto Metro Station, Relais della Torre features accommodations in Rome, with a shared lounge. Among the facilities at this property are an elevator and a shared kitchen, along with free Wifi throughout the property. The property is a 4-minute...
8.9 Excellent
Recommended by guests
Castel Sant’Angelo Design Apartment
Castel Sant’Angelo Design Apartment Map Castel Sant’Angelo Design Apartment
285 via cola di rienzo, 00192 Roma
Castel Sant'Angelo Design Apartment offers accommodations in Rome, a 9-minute walk from The Vatican and 0.7 miles from Castel Sant'Angelo. This apartment provides an elevator and free Wifi. The property is a 4-minute walk from Ottaviano Metro Station and within 1.2 miles of the city center. This apartment...
8.7 Excellent
Recommended by guests
Casa Novecento Prati
Casa Novecento Prati Map Casa Novecento Prati
285 via cola di rienzo 8, 00192 Roma
Casa Novecento Prati offers accommodations in Rome, a 9-minute walk from The Vatican and 0.7 miles from Castel Sant'Angelo. This apartment provides air-conditioned accommodations with free Wifi. The property is 1.2 miles from the city center and a 4-minute walk from Ottaviano Metro Station. The apartment...
6.5 Pleasant
Giant Cola di Rienzo Apartment
Giant Cola di Rienzo Apartment Map Giant Cola di Rienzo Apartment
285 via cola di rienzo, 00192 Roma
Giant Cola di Rienzo Apartment in Rome provides accommodations with free Wifi, a 9-minute walk from Vatican Museums, 0.6 miles from Lepanto Metro Station, and a 8-minute walk from St Peter's Square. The property is close to several well-known attractions, a 19-minute walk from Piazza del Popolo, 1.1...
9 Exceptional
Via Tolemaide Private Apartment
Via Tolemaide Private Apartment Map Via Tolemaide Private Apartment
28 via tolemaide int. 10, 00192 Roma
Via Tolemaide Private Apartment offers accommodations in Rome, a 12-minute walk from St Peter's Square and 0.7 miles from The Vatican. This apartment offers an elevator and free Wifi. St. Peter's Basilica is a 15-minute walk from the apartment and Piazza Navona is 1.7 miles away. The air-conditioned...
9.3 Exceptional
Tolemaide Orange Apartment
Tolemaide Orange Apartment Map Tolemaide Orange Apartment
28 via tolemaide, 00192 Roma
Tolemaide Orange Apartment offers accommodations in Rome, 1.1 miles from Castel Sant'Angelo and 1.9 miles from Piazza del Popolo. The property is around a 12-minute walk from The Vatican, 0.8 miles from St. Peter's Basilica, and 1.7 miles from Piazza Navona. Free Wifi is available throughout the property...
9.8 Magnificent
Casa Rica at Vatican and St Peter
Casa Rica at Vatican and St Peter Map Casa Rica at Vatican and St Peter
9 via gabriele camozzi, 00192 Roma
Casa Rica at Vatican and St Peter in Rome provides accommodations with free Wifi, a 4-minute walk from Ottaviano Metro Station, half a mile from Lepanto Metro Station, and a 11-minute walk from Vatican Museums. The property is around 1.6 miles from Piazza del Popolo, 1.6 miles from Piazza Navona, and...
Musei Vaticani Holidays
Musei Vaticani Holidays Map Musei Vaticani Holidays
22 via sebastiano veniero, 00192 Roma
Just a 4-minute walk from Ottaviano Metro Station and 0.7 miles from Lepanto Metro Station, Musei Vaticani Holidays features accommodations in Rome with a shared lounge. Featuring garden and inner courtyard views, this vacation home also offers free Wifi. The property is a 2-minute walk from Vatican...
8.7 Excellent
Elena’s house
Elena’s house Map Elena’s house
22 via sebastiano veniero 12 piano 2, 00192 Roma
Elena's house is a recently renovated apartment in the center of Rome, a 2-minute walk from Vatican Museums and 400 yards from Ottaviano Metro Station. Housed in a building dating from 1900, this apartment is 1.5 miles from Piazza Navona and a 18-minute walk from Castel Sant'Angelo. Free Wifi is available...
9.8 Magnificent
Book a ferry Book a flight Book a car
Places nearby
Points of interest

Hospitals

  • 0.2 km Casa di Cura Santa Rita da Cascia 7561
  • 0.6 km Casa di Cura Santa Famiglia 7567
  • 0.8 km Ospedale Regionale Oftalmico 7529

Museums and Libraries

  • 0.2 km Museo di Zoologia Sezione Entomologica 7559
  • 0.3 km Museo dell'Arma dei Carabinieri 7563
  • 0.4 km Museo Storico dell'Arma dei Carabinieri 7565
  • 0.7 km Museo degli Orrori di Dario Argento 7567
  • 0.8 km Museo Storico-Artistico o Tesoro di San Pietro 7569

Monuments

  • 0.3 km Pinacoteca Vaticana 7553
  • 0.4 km Musei Vaticani 7555
  • 0.7 km Vaticano e San Pietro 7562
  • 0.8 km Santa Maria in Traspontina 7576
  • 0.8 km Palazzo Torlonia 7575
  • 0.8 km Pietà di Michelangelo 7569
  • 0.8 km Palazzo dei Penitenzieri 7576

Stations

  • 0.7 km Lepanto 7563

Universities

  • 0.8 km LUMSA Libera Università Maria Santissima Assunta 7576

Churches

  • 0.8 km Basilica di San Pietro 7567
  • 0.8 km Cappella Sistina 7562

Airports

  • 6 km Aeroporto di Roma - Urbe 7376